Firing pin assembly 7, under the pretightning force effect of preloading spring, presses with nozzle pad, stops fluid to flow out, is closed, and fluid is full of the gap between firing pin assembly 7 and cavity under pressure.Under the on-off control of electromagnetic valve, compressed air enters in main valve body 11, promotes firing pin assembly 7 to move upward, until with end in contact under stroke adjustment seat, and stop one section of reasonable time in this position, now, striker separates with nozzle pad, and fluid enters nozzle pad.Work as solenoid closure, striker under the force of a spring, fast ram nozzle pad, it is the kinetic energy that striker moves downward by the precompressed potential energy converting and energy of spring, fluid is cut-off in flow process, sprays out by nozzle with glue drop-wise by fluid in Guan Bi moment, completes a working cycle.Striker stops one section of reasonable time equally in its lowest position, and motion starts the next period of motion then up.The movement travel of striker can be adjusted by regulation stroke adjustment seat;
For different fluid behaviours, the pretightning force to glue valve and stroke is needed to be set and regulate.The pretightning force of precise pneumatic formula lever injection valve and travel parameters independent regulation, be independent of each other.Preloading spring pretightning force size can be realized by rotating the position of pretension regulation spring, thus change the acceleration that striker moves downward;Position by rotating distance adjustment seat can realize the setting of firing pin assembly move distance, reaches to change the purpose of gel quantity.
Feed pressure directly affects glue valve effect for dispensing glue with the size of supply gas pressure, and feed pressure is the least, and fluid can not be full of nozzle pad and nozzle;Feed pressure is too big, in valve opening moment, directly flows out from nozzle, it is impossible to form spraying.The size firing pin assembly to be enough to ensure that of supply gas pressure can move up and down smoothly.During the regulation carrying out gel quantity, four factors are had can directly to change its size, i.e. feed pressure, glue stroke of valve, nozzle specification and the switch time of electromagnetic valve and get number ready.Due to different application scenarios, it may be necessary to the cooperation of different parameters and accessory can be only achieved preferable product effect, it is not recommended that change some parameter therein blindly.We follow to use and minimum get number and the shortest time, the principle of production best product ready.Number and duration of valve opening are got in unconfined increase ready, can aggravate the wear out failure of product and may cause cannot realizing spraying effect for dispensing glue.
This spraying glue dispensing valve is money contactless spraying glue dispensing valve, can be widely applied to the flow-controllable of all kinds of adhesive, at a high speed the some glue operations such as surface adhesive, conductive silver paste, IC packaging plastic, underfill, fluid sealant, surface coating glue.The narrow space of little to hundred microns can be injected, also glue can be precisely put specifying position complete weight to 0.01 milligram of rank.Precise pneumatic formula lever injection valve can with complete automatization's point glue platform, Electronic Packaging industry, illuminating industry, energy industry, Life Science and other need high accuracy, high efficiency and the occasion that has space to limit to be that client brings maximum economic benefit.
